Historic Westhaven Lodge on Lake Vermilion - Since 1935

In existence since 1935, Westhaven Lodge has a private setting with a premier location on the south side of Big Bay of Lake Vermilion. Recently remodeled, the 3,200 sq. ft. single-story lodge has its own large dock with a 4,000-lb. boat lift, a fire ring, a wood-burning sauna, a fish cleaning house, a swing set and playhouse, and a large pebble beach that it shares with our two-bedroom seasonal cabin (Cabin 1 at Westhaven Lodge--which is also available for rent if you need more than six bedrooms for your group).

The lodge can easily handle a large crowd. The master bedroom faces the lake and has a queen bed; two more bedrooms with lake views also contain queen beds; and a fourth bedroom has a full bed. Two more bedrooms contain multiple bunk beds. The lodge also has a large great room with a beautiful granite fireplace, a spacious four-season porch, a large kitchen, and a large dining room that can fit up to 16 at the table.

Because the sun rises and sets so far to the north in the summer, and because we're on a little point, Westhaven Lodge is ideal for watching both as it faces due north with more than a180-degree view of Big Bay.

The Lodge's large dock has a main boat lift that can accommodate a speed boat or fishing boat up to 4,000 pounds, and a second smaller boat lift can take up to 2,400 pounds. The nearest free boat launch is just over a mile away, and a large parking lot and trailer storage area also serve both structures.

Other features include a baby grand piano, a playhouse, a swing set and a basketball hoop. (The nearest pickleball courts are only a mile or so away at the Greenwood Township Hall, as is a tennis court and a large picnic shelter.)

About the host

Hosted by Rodger Skare

Host profile image
The Skare family bought Westhaven Lodge, all of its cabins, and an additional 20 acres of heavily-wooded upland back in 1978 and operated the entire property as a resort for 20 years. Most of the original cabins making up the resort still exist, but the six furthest to the west were sold off to two great families who are now great neighbors. The next generation of the Skare Family continues to rent out the Lodge and Cabin 1, which were (and still are) the best of the original cabins.
